Think About You (Luther Vandross song)

"Think About You" is a song by American singer-songwriter Luther Vandross. It was written by Vandross and James Porte for his 2003 album, Dance with My Father, with production helmed by the former. "Think About You" was minor hit after its single release, and would later peak to number 30 on the US Billboard Hot R&B/Hip-Hop Songs chart.[1]
